Dr. Timothy Busey is an experienced optometrist qualified to diagnose and treat eye conditions, and a dedicated member of his community. Learn more below.

Dr. Busey grew up in Georgetown, IL, and graduated from Hope Christian High School in Danville, IL. Early in his career, he knew he wanted to be in the medical field.

He then attended Millikin University where he studied pre-med, then attended Illinois College of Optometry in Chicago, IL, where he received his Doctor of Optometry degree. While in Chicago he had the opportunity to do an externship at the Ft. Sheridan Army base.

Presently Dr. Busey resides in the Decatur, IL area with his wife, Debra, and children, Brandon and Jacob. His daughter Kelly lives in Champaign, IL where she is a student. He has been seeing patients in the Decatur area for almost 25 years. He provides eye care for the entire family, including contacts and diagnosis and treatment of ocular disease, with experience providing pre- and post-operative cataract examinations. Dr. Busey is DPA and TPA certified which allows for the diagnosis and treatment of eye conditions.

In his free time, Dr. Busey enjoys running and has completed several Marathons. Dr. Busey is a member of Tabernacle Baptist Church in Decatur where he serves as a Sunday School teacher and is currently a deacon. He enjoys going on Mission trips with his church and has been to China, Africa, and recently Alaska. He is a member of the Illinois Optometric Association and the American Optometric Association.
